Mastering Financial Discipline
A rich man is not only defined by what he earns but also by what he saves and invests. Practicing financial discipline ensures that we retain and grow wealth over time.
- Live Below Your Means: Luxury today can cost future financial freedom. Control spending and focus on essentials.
- Create a Budget and Stick to It: Tracking income and expenses helps identify areas of waste.
- Build an Emergency Fund: A safety net of at least 6–12 months’ expenses prevents financial setbacks.
Discipline creates stability, and stability enables growth.

Avoiding Common Wealth-Destroying Habits
To become wealthy, we must avoid pitfalls that drain financial stability.
- Excessive Debt: High-interest loans and credit card debt cripple financial progress.
- Uncontrolled Spending: Lavish lifestyles without assets lead to financial collapse.
- Procrastination: Delaying investments and opportunities reduces long-term growth.
- Ignoring Risks: Lack of insurance, poor investments, and neglecting diversification expose us to losses.
The rich build safeguards to protect wealth while continuing to expand it.
